gpt4 book ai didi

image - 是否可以从连续创建的 jpeg 图像创建视频流(mpeg 或 mjpeg)?

转载 作者:行者123 更新时间:2023-12-02 17:08:54 24 4
gpt4 key购买 nike

我需要创建显示低功耗嵌入式设备的屏幕抓取视频流。它没有运行桌面共享服务实时 VNC 的能力。但它可以每秒通过 API 向在别处运行的单独 HTTP 客户端提供 2-3 个屏幕截图。

有没有一种方法可以根据通过连续运行 Screenshot API 检索到的图像创建视频流。

最佳答案

您可以使用 ffmpeg 使用连续的 jpeg 文件创建实时视频流,它将使用图像创建 mpeg 格式的视频。

Ffmpeg 是一个处理视频、音频和其他多媒体文件的软件项目。您可以使用 ffmpeg 类库项目或命令行 exe 应用程序来使用 ffmpeg。如果图像本地存储在计算机中,您可以直接以 2 或 3 帧速率输入这些图像来创建视频。例如,您可以使用以下 ffmpeg 命令创建包含多个图像的视频文件。

ffmpeg -framerate 24 -i %d.jpg output.mp4

在上面的命令中 -i 是输入路径,它会生成 output.mp4 文件。同样,您可以使用以下命令创建实时 mpegts udp 流。

ffmpeg -loop 1 -i %d.jpg -r 10 -vcodec mpeg4 -f mpegts udp://127.0.0.1:1234

关于image - 是否可以从连续创建的 jpeg 图像创建视频流(mpeg 或 mjpeg)?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50267629/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com